pub struct FeatureRankingRow {Show 32 fields
pub ranking_strategy: String,
pub ranking_formula: String,
pub feature_index: usize,
pub feature_name: String,
pub dsfb_raw_boundary_points: usize,
pub dsfb_persistent_boundary_points: usize,
pub dsfb_raw_violation_points: usize,
pub dsfb_persistent_violation_points: usize,
pub ewma_alarm_points: usize,
pub threshold_alarm_points: usize,
pub pre_failure_run_hits: usize,
pub motif_precision_proxy: Option<f64>,
pub recall_rescue_contribution: Option<f64>,
pub operator_burden_contribution: Option<f64>,
pub semantic_persistence_contribution: Option<f64>,
pub grouped_semantic_support: Option<f64>,
pub violation_overdominance_penalty: Option<f64>,
pub missing_fraction: f64,
pub z_pre_failure_run_hits: Option<f64>,
pub z_motif_precision_proxy: Option<f64>,
pub z_recall_rescue_contribution: Option<f64>,
pub z_operator_burden_contribution: Option<f64>,
pub z_semantic_persistence_contribution: Option<f64>,
pub z_grouped_semantic_support: Option<f64>,
pub z_violation_overdominance_penalty: Option<f64>,
pub z_boundary: f64,
pub z_violation: f64,
pub z_ewma: f64,
pub missingness_penalty: f64,
pub candidate_score: f64,
pub score_breakdown: String,
pub rank: usize,
}Fields§
§ranking_strategy: String§ranking_formula: String§feature_index: usize§feature_name: String§dsfb_raw_boundary_points: usize§dsfb_persistent_boundary_points: usize§dsfb_raw_violation_points: usize§dsfb_persistent_violation_points: usize§ewma_alarm_points: usize§threshold_alarm_points: usize§pre_failure_run_hits: usize§motif_precision_proxy: Option<f64>§recall_rescue_contribution: Option<f64>§operator_burden_contribution: Option<f64>§semantic_persistence_contribution: Option<f64>§grouped_semantic_support: Option<f64>§violation_overdominance_penalty: Option<f64>§missing_fraction: f64§z_pre_failure_run_hits: Option<f64>§z_motif_precision_proxy: Option<f64>§z_recall_rescue_contribution: Option<f64>§z_operator_burden_contribution: Option<f64>§z_semantic_persistence_contribution: Option<f64>§z_grouped_semantic_support: Option<f64>§z_violation_overdominance_penalty: Option<f64>§z_boundary: f64§z_violation: f64§z_ewma: f64§missingness_penalty: f64§candidate_score: f64§score_breakdown: String§rank: usizeTrait Implementations§
Source§impl Clone for FeatureRankingRow
impl Clone for FeatureRankingRow
Source§fn clone(&self) -> FeatureRankingRow
fn clone(&self) -> FeatureRankingRow
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for FeatureRankingRow
impl Debug for FeatureRankingRow
Auto Trait Implementations§
impl Freeze for FeatureRankingRow
impl RefUnwindSafe for FeatureRankingRow
impl Send for FeatureRankingRow
impl Sync for FeatureRankingRow
impl Unpin for FeatureRankingRow
impl UnsafeUnpin for FeatureRankingRow
impl UnwindSafe for FeatureRankingRow
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more